Predicting type of protein-protein interaction as a multiple-instance learning problem Hiroshi Yamakawa, Yoshio Nakao, Koji Maruhashi (FUJITSU LAB.) |

We propose a method for predicting types of protein-protein interactions using a multiple-instance learning (MIL) model. By assuming cause of each interaction between proteins containing two or more subunit is results from local subunit pairs, we formulates this problem as MIL. In this problem, influences from instances in negative bag to target concepts are too strong by using well-known Maron’s method. We propose a new MIL method based on decision by majority and apply to the KEGG interaction data. In an experiment using the KEGG pathways and the Gene Ontology, the method successfully predicted an interaction type (phosphorylation) at the accuracy rate of 86.1%. We find that cause of false positive is caused by positive bias peculiar to MIL method by analyzing prediction results. |
